Transaction 76f859a3113e40a06b1e23c4ea178bfcee2b25c44a5bfda5bf4d28f489a19ce3
1 Input
1 Output
-
76f859a3113e40a06b1e23c4ea178bfcee2b25c44a5bfda5bf4d28f489a19ce3:0
- value
- 702304
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ad3bc5d63afed88564c2539b6ca6e60a7209220 OP_EQUAL
- address
- 348s9C8JSj6b581DA6pPUDcA9ekAtzUrCZ